C waitforexit msdn - Waitforexit msdn


According to this link the WaitForExit( ) method is used to make the current thread wait until the associated process terminates. However, the Process does have an. Let' s read what MSDN says about it: The WaitForExit ( ) overload is used to make the current thread wait until the associated process terminates. The maximum is the largest possible value of a 32- bit integer, which represents infinity to the operating system.

Waitforexit问题讨论, 龙卷风的网易博客, 更多交流,. Public Function WaitForExit ( milliseconds As Integer) As Boolean. If a child process writes enough data to the pipe to fill the buffer, the child will block until the parent reads the data from the pipe. This method instructs the Process component to wait an infinite amount of time for the process to exit.
ReadToEnd before p. It will NOT make your form hide or minimise at all, unless you tell your code to do this before calling WaitForExit( ).

C waitforexit msdn. WaitForExit before p.

WaitForInputIdle( ) WaitForInputIdle( ) WaitForInputIdle( ) WaitForInputIdle( ). WaitForExit makes the current thread wait until the associated process terminates. A deadlock condition can result if the parent process calls p. This can cause an application to stop responding.
Milliseconds Int32 Int32 Int32 Int32. To avoid blocking the current thread, use the Exited event.

The amount of time, in milliseconds, to wait for the associated process to exit. However, the Process does have an Exited event that you can hook into. 8/ 8/ · WaitForExit( ) is a thread blocking method which will do exactly just that - wait for a process to exit before it continues with your code. For example, if you call CloseMainWindow for a process that has a.
8/ 5/ · " The Process component communicates with a child process using a pipe. It should be called after all other methods are called on the process.

MSDN Subscription. ReadToEnd and the child process writes enough text to fill the redirected stream.

This overload of WaitForExit instructs the Process component to wait an infinite amount of time for the process to exit. From msdn: The code example avoids a deadlock condition by calling p.

WaitForExit is used to make the current thread wait until the associated process terminates. WaitForExit( Int32) WaitForExit( Int32) WaitForExit( Int32) WaitForExit( Int32) Instructs the Process component to wait the specified number of milliseconds for the associated process to exit.

C-WAITFOREXIT-MSDN